Yes it's normal, you'll probably start waking up with little colostrum spots on your shirts. It shouldn't be a lot, just a few drops. Don't play with or squeeze your boobs because that can get contractions going.
Playing with your nipples for a while gets contractions going. Yes it's fine to put lotion n stuff on them but just don't sit there and try to squeeze colostrum out or when having a little fun with your so, don't let em play with them too much.
This is extremely common and yes, nipple stimulation can start contractions.
